AJAX - STAR MAN - RAFAEL VAN DER VAART

RAFAEL van der Vaart was being tipped to be Dutch football's next superstar after making his debut aged just 17 and he is now well on his way to fulfilling that prediction.

The midfield maestro has emerged on the scene in 1999 when Co Adriaanse dropped veteran Richard Witschge to bring in van der Vaart.

Within six months he was a regular in the first team and has gone on to make over 70 appearances for the club scoring an impressive 39 goals in the process.

His form saw him picked for Holland in October 21 against Andorra and with this he became the fourth youngest player to play for his country since the Second World War.

He had been capped as youngster from a very tender age for Holland's youth teams, as the Dutch authorities knew he has a Spanish mother and that Spain were already interested in his abilities when he was a young teenager.

Obviously his talents of not gone unnoticed and Premiership sides Manchester United, Liverpool and Arsenal have been looking, but the player himself is thought to prefer a move to Spain.
